Output 3175cbaaa0e2f06bf5d52ef897bf806295f7275542b0faeaa7c7954234adf0d3:17

value
16291483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77924ed6fc0a0981832210ea1afdd7a0c091c13f OP_EQUAL
address
3CbFc2YRebtFQD2TKQnKns3eQvS7kCedga
transaction
3175cbaaa0e2f06bf5d52ef897bf806295f7275542b0faeaa7c7954234adf0d3
spent
true